You Can’t Hide from Your Bad Data Anymore! – Network to Code Triple-T

Network automation and AI promise faster, smarter operations—but only if your data can keep up. In this session, we’ll explore why accurate, contextualized network data is the foundation for automation at scale. Drawing parallels between the rise of automation and the next wave of AI adoption, we’ll show how data gaps derail efficiency, slow innovation, and increase risk. Learn practical steps enterprises are taking to establish a reliable Network Source of Truth, power event-driven workflows, and prepare their infrastructure for AI-driven operations.

Speakers:

Jeff Bradbury has over 20 years’ experience in demanding and progressively challenging management positions, and over 15 years focusing exclusively on Marketing and Sales excellence. With an extensive background as a marketing executive, Jeff has successfully led a variety of technology companies through critical high-growth phases. As the Vice President of Marketing for Network to Code, Jeff spearheads strategic growth initiatives, shapes market positioning, and fosters customer engagement. His efforts guide clients into and through their network automation journeys.

Jeff Bradbury previously held executive marketing positions at several companies, including ALL.SPACE, Hughes Network Systems, B.E. Meyers, and Fortress Technologies. While at Hughes, Jeff oversaw the creation of the marketing team and launch of their SD-WAN portfolio. And while at Fortress Technologies he drove the market expansion and growth strategy that saw Fortress Technologies more than double in size and led to its acquisition by General Dynamics. Jeff holds a Master of Business Administration in Marketing from George Washington University and a Bachelor of Science degree in Mechanical Engineering from the U.S. Naval Academy
